news 2026/4/23 11:27:47

NoSleep:轻量级Windows防休眠工具,让电脑永不停歇

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
NoSleep:轻量级Windows防休眠工具,让电脑永不停歇

你是否经历过视频会议时电脑突然休眠的尴尬?或者深夜赶工时因屏幕锁定而丢失未保存的文档?NoSleep正是为解决这些痛点而生的一款轻量级Windows防休眠工具,它无需管理员权限,通过极简设计实现系统状态的持续守护,是程序员、远程工作者和多媒体创作者的理想伴侣。

【免费下载链接】NoSleepLightweight Windows utility to prevent screen locking项目地址: https://gitcode.com/gh_mirrors/nos/NoSleep

🚀 突破权限限制:零门槛使用体验

NoSleep最引人瞩目的优势在于其"零门槛"使用体验。不同于传统需要修改注册表或组策略的防休眠方案,这款工具通过用户级API调用即可实现功能,完美规避企业电脑的权限限制。

这款128x128分辨率的咖啡杯图标完美诠释了工具的核心理念——就像一杯热咖啡让你的大脑保持清醒,NoSleep让你的电脑永不停歇。

⚡ 核心技术:智能防休眠机制

NoSleep的核心原理基于Windows系统提供的SetThreadExecutionState函数,通过组合调用三个关键参数构建起多层次的防休眠屏障:

  • ES_CONTINUOUS:持续保持防休眠状态
  • ES_SYSTEM_REQUIRED:确保系统活跃运行
  • ES_DISPLAY_REQUIRED:维持显示器常亮状态

独特的"智能刷新机制"通过每10秒重置一次系统空闲计时器,既确保了防休眠效果,又避免了资源浪费问题。

🎯 多场景应用:满足不同使用需求

办公会议场景

在双屏办公环境中,NoSleep展现出卓越的兼容性。开启工具后,主副显示器均能保持常亮状态,确保视频会议和文档编辑的连续性。

多媒体创作

在持续8小时的视频渲染测试中,工具全程稳定运行,有效防止了因系统休眠导致的工作中断。

远程工作支持

对于受限于企业政策无法修改系统电源设置的用户,NoSleep提供了完美的解决方案。

📊 性能表现:轻量高效运行

实测数据显示,NoSleep的内存占用稳定在6-7MB区间,CPU使用率趋近于零。程序主体与图标资源总大小不足200KB,可直接放入U盘随身携带,真正做到"即插即用"的绿色软件标准。

🛠️ 快速上手:三步完成配置

基础操作流程十分简单:

  1. 启动程序:双击NoSleep.exe即可运行
  2. 状态监控:系统托盘出现咖啡杯图标(绿色表示启用,灰色表示禁用)
  3. 功能切换:左键单击图标快速切换防休眠状态

高级配置选项

  • 勾选"Keep screen on"选项可单独控制显示器常亮
  • 选择"Autostart at login"实现系统启动时自动加载
  • 通过创建快捷方式并添加启动参数实现个性化配置

🔄 持续进化:开源社区的力量

作为采用Unlicense协议的开源项目,NoSleep拥有活跃的开发者社区。项目特别欢迎针对多显示器适配、快捷键定制等功能的PR贡献。

核心源码路径:Sources/NoSleep/项目配置文件:Sources/NoSleep/NoSleep.csproj

💡 使用建议:个性化场景配置

根据不同的使用场景,推荐以下配置方案:

  • 会议场景:启用"系统+显示"双重防护
  • 日常办公:仅开启系统防护以节省能源
  • 服务器环境:配合任务计划程序实现无人值守运行

无论你是需要长时间运行的开发者,还是希望避免意外中断的普通用户,NoSleep都能以其独特的轻量化设计,为你的Windows系统提供稳定可靠的状态守护。让这款工具成为你数字生活中的得力助手,确保每一次重要工作都能顺利完成!

【免费下载链接】NoSleepLightweight Windows utility to prevent screen locking项目地址: https://gitcode.com/gh_mirrors/nos/NoSleep

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:01:46

Steam成就解锁神器:3分钟轻松管理所有游戏成就

Steam成就解锁神器:3分钟轻松管理所有游戏成就 【免费下载链接】SteamAchievementManager A manager for game achievements in Steam. 项目地址: https://gitcode.com/gh_mirrors/st/SteamAchievementManager 还在为那些难以达成的游戏成就而烦恼吗&#xf…

作者头像 李华
网站建设 2026/4/23 10:50:10

MyTV-Android多线路播放源终极配置指南

还在为电视直播频繁卡顿而烦恼吗?MyTV-Android播放器为您带来了革命性的多线路播放源解决方案!通过智能线路切换机制,让您的观影体验从此告别中断,享受流畅播放的乐趣。 【免费下载链接】mytv-android 使用Android原生开发的电视直…

作者头像 李华
网站建设 2026/4/23 13:45:20

OctIM多用户在线客服系统源码_开源、高效、可定制

在当今高度数字化的商业环境中,客户服务体验已成为企业竞争力的关键指标。用户期望“秒级响应、无缝沟通、多端一致”的服务支持,传统电话或邮件客服已难以满足这一需求。为此,越来越多企业开始部署多用户在线客服系统,以实现高效…

作者头像 李华
网站建设 2026/4/23 4:25:49

3个核心场景讲透工业HMI在自动化系统中到底起什么作用?

很多新手知道HMI是“人机桥梁”,但具体在工业系统里怎么用?这篇文章结合实际场景,拆解它的3个核心作用,帮你建立“系统思维”。工业自动化系统通常由“感知层(传感器)→控制层(PLC/变频器&#…

作者头像 李华
网站建设 2026/4/17 18:10:35

5分钟掌握Krita智能选区:AI图像分割技术实战指南

5分钟掌握Krita智能选区:AI图像分割技术实战指南 【免费下载链接】krita-ai-tools Krita plugin which adds selection tools to mask objects with a single click, or by drawing a bounding box. 项目地址: https://gitcode.com/gh_mirrors/kr/krita-ai-tools …

作者头像 李华
网站建设 2026/4/23 12:25:15

Vue 3 组件通信方式全面解析与实战指南

Vue 3 组件通信方式全面解析与实战指南 从父子组件简单的数据传递,到复杂应用的状态共享,Vue 3 提供了多样且高效的组件通信方案。 1. 引言:为什么需要多种通信方式? 在 Vue 应用开发中,组件化是核心思想。随着应用规模的增长,组件之间的关系变得复杂,组件间如何高效、…

作者头像 李华